Lupane Predator Convicted of Molesting Mentally Challenged Blind Woman
A predator from Lupane has been arrested and convicted for molesting a mentally challenged woman who is also blind, deaf, and dumb.
The Horrifying Encounter
According to the reports, the harrowing incident took place on the 24th of June, 2024, around 8 pm. The 38-year-old victim had retired to bed after finishing her supper with her mother. After sleeping for some time, she went outside to the toilet. It was at this moment that the 27-year-old predator, upon realizing the woman’s vulnerability, decided to enter her bedroom.

Caught in the Act

The woman, upon returning to her bed, found the predator already nestled under her blankets. To her horror, she found herself being molested countless times. Just then, the woman’s brother arrived and made a disturbing discovery. Shining his flashlight, he was confronted with the sight of the predator in the midst of assaulting his sister.
Justice Served
The predator attempted to flee the scene but was apprehended by the woman’s brother. He then took him to the police station where he was apprehended. An examination was conducted, and the results confirmed the woman’s assault, as semen was discovered on her private parts.

Severe Punishment

The predator appeared before the Hwange Magistrate Courts facing rape charges and was found guilty. He was sentenced to 24 months in prison.

“The accused person was sentenced to 24 months imprisonment for unlawful entry and 20 years imprisonment for rape. He will serve 22 years effectively,” read the NPAZ press statement.
